Title :
Diversity reception schemes for COFDM in a mobile environment utilizing soft-bit information
Author_Institution :
Digital Media Inst./Telecommun., Tampere Univ. of Technol., Finland
Abstract :
Some comparative results on simple new diversity combining schemes are presented to be used with coded orthogonal frequency division multiplexing (COFDM) systems in multipath channels with time selective fading. The performance is evaluated by simulation using DVB-T (digital video broadcasting-terrestrial) system parameters
